The Critical Role of ERP in Healthcare Procurement Operations
Healthcare organizations face unique procurement challenges due to the critical nature of medical supplies, stringent regulatory requirements, and complex vendor ecosystems. Unlike general manufacturing or retail, healthcare procurement must balance cost efficiency with patient safety, regulatory compliance, and supply continuity. An Enterprise Resource Planning (ERP) system serves as the central nervous system for these operations, integrating financial, inventory, and vendor data into a unified platform. This integration enables healthcare leaders to enforce contract compliance, streamline supply workflows, and gain real-time visibility into procurement activities. Without a robust ERP foundation, organizations risk fragmented data, manual errors, and non-compliance with healthcare regulations.
The core value of ERP in healthcare procurement lies in its ability to standardize processes across departments. Procurement, finance, inventory management, and clinical operations often operate in silos, leading to misaligned priorities and inefficient workflows. ERP systems bridge these gaps by providing a single source of truth for procurement data. This unified view allows organizations to track every purchase order from initiation to delivery, ensuring that all transactions adhere to predefined contracts and compliance standards. Furthermore, ERP platforms facilitate automated workflows that reduce manual intervention, minimize errors, and accelerate procurement cycles. For healthcare executives, this translates to improved operational efficiency, reduced costs, and enhanced patient care through reliable supply chains.
Understanding Healthcare Procurement Challenges
Healthcare procurement is inherently complex due to the diverse range of items purchased, from pharmaceuticals and medical devices to consumables and capital equipment. Each category has specific regulatory requirements, storage conditions, and usage protocols. For example, pharmaceuticals require strict temperature controls and expiration date tracking, while medical devices may need certification verification and maintenance schedules. These complexities demand a procurement system that can handle detailed item attributes, compliance checks, and workflow variations. Traditional spreadsheet-based or standalone procurement tools often lack the granularity and integration capabilities needed to manage these nuances effectively.
Another significant challenge is vendor management. Healthcare organizations typically work with hundreds or thousands of vendors, each with different contract terms, pricing structures, and delivery schedules. Managing these relationships manually is impractical and error-prone. ERP systems provide centralized vendor master data, contract management modules, and performance tracking capabilities. This allows procurement teams to monitor vendor compliance, negotiate better terms, and identify underperforming suppliers. Additionally, healthcare procurement must account for emergency situations where supply continuity is critical. ERP systems enable rapid response by providing real-time inventory visibility and automated replenishment triggers, ensuring that essential supplies are always available.
Contract Compliance and Governance in Healthcare Procurement
Contract compliance is a cornerstone of healthcare procurement operations. Healthcare organizations enter into long-term contracts with vendors to secure favorable pricing, guaranteed supply, and service levels. However, ensuring that every purchase order adheres to these contracts is challenging without automated controls. ERP systems enforce contract compliance by linking purchase orders to specific contract terms. When a user initiates a purchase order, the system automatically validates the item, quantity, and price against the active contract. If discrepancies are detected, the system flags the transaction for review, preventing non-compliant purchases. This automated validation reduces the risk of overpayments, unauthorized purchases, and contract breaches.
Governance in healthcare procurement extends beyond contract compliance to include audit trails, segregation of duties, and regulatory reporting. Healthcare organizations are subject to strict auditing requirements from regulatory bodies and internal compliance teams. ERP systems provide comprehensive audit trails that record every action taken in the procurement process, from purchase order creation to invoice payment. These audit trails are immutable and timestamped, ensuring data integrity and accountability. Additionally, ERP platforms support segregation of duties by enforcing role-based access controls. For example, the user who creates a purchase order cannot also approve it or process the payment. This separation reduces the risk of fraud and ensures that procurement processes are transparent and auditable.
Optimizing Supply Workflows with ERP Automation
Supply workflows in healthcare procurement involve multiple steps, from demand forecasting to purchase order issuance, delivery, and invoice reconciliation. Manual handling of these steps is time-consuming and prone to errors. ERP systems automate these workflows by defining standard operating procedures and triggering actions based on predefined rules. For example, when inventory levels fall below a reorder point, the system can automatically generate a purchase requisition. Once approved, the requisition is converted into a purchase order and sent to the vendor. This automation reduces cycle times, improves accuracy, and frees up procurement staff to focus on strategic activities such as vendor negotiation and supply chain optimization.
Workflow automation also enhances exception handling in healthcare procurement. Exceptions, such as delayed deliveries, price changes, or quality issues, are common in supply chains. ERP systems provide dashboards and alerts that highlight exceptions in real time, enabling procurement teams to respond quickly. For instance, if a vendor fails to deliver a critical item by the promised date, the system can notify the procurement manager and suggest alternative suppliers. This proactive approach minimizes the impact of supply disruptions on patient care. Furthermore, ERP platforms support collaborative workflows, allowing multiple stakeholders to review and approve transactions. This ensures that all parties are aligned and that decisions are made with full context.
Data Integration and Master Data Management
Effective healthcare procurement operations rely on accurate and consistent data. ERP systems integrate data from various sources, including inventory management, financial systems, and vendor portals. This integration ensures that procurement decisions are based on up-to-date information. For example, inventory data from the warehouse management system is synchronized with the ERP, providing real-time visibility into stock levels. Financial data from the general ledger is linked to procurement transactions, enabling accurate cost tracking and budget management. This data integration eliminates silos and provides a holistic view of procurement operations.
Master data management (MDM) is critical for maintaining data quality in healthcare procurement. Master data includes item descriptions, vendor details, contract terms, and pricing information. Inconsistent or outdated master data can lead to procurement errors, compliance issues, and financial discrepancies. ERP systems provide MDM capabilities that standardize and validate master data across the organization. For example, when a new item is added to the system, the MDM module ensures that the item description, unit of measure, and tax classification are consistent with existing records. This standardization reduces errors and improves the reliability of procurement data. Additionally, MDM supports data governance by defining ownership, stewardship, and quality metrics for master data.
Reporting and Analytics for Procurement Insights
Reporting and analytics are essential for monitoring procurement performance and identifying areas for improvement. ERP systems provide built-in reporting tools that generate standard reports on procurement spend, vendor performance, and inventory levels. These reports help procurement managers track key performance indicators (KPIs) such as cost savings, on-time delivery rates, and contract compliance. For example, a spend analysis report can reveal which vendors are driving the most spend and whether pricing is within contract terms. This insight enables procurement teams to negotiate better deals and identify opportunities for cost reduction.
Advanced analytics capabilities in ERP systems go beyond standard reporting to provide predictive insights. For instance, predictive analytics can forecast future demand based on historical data, seasonal trends, and clinical usage patterns. This allows procurement teams to optimize inventory levels and avoid stockouts or overstocking. Additionally, analytics can identify patterns in vendor performance, such as frequent delays or quality issues, enabling proactive vendor management. By leveraging data-driven insights, healthcare organizations can make more informed procurement decisions, improve supply chain resilience, and enhance patient care.
Security, Compliance, and Regulatory Considerations
Healthcare procurement involves sensitive data, including patient information, financial records, and vendor contracts. Ensuring the security and privacy of this data is paramount. ERP systems implement robust security measures, including encryption, access controls, and audit logs, to protect data from unauthorized access and breaches. Role-based access controls ensure that users can only view and modify data relevant to their roles. For example, a procurement clerk can create purchase orders but cannot access financial reports. This least-privilege approach minimizes the risk of data exposure and ensures compliance with data protection regulations.
Regulatory compliance is another critical consideration in healthcare procurement. Organizations must adhere to regulations such as HIPAA, FDA guidelines, and local healthcare laws. ERP systems support compliance by providing features such as electronic signatures, audit trails, and regulatory reporting. For example, electronic signatures ensure that procurement documents are legally binding and tamper-proof. Audit trails provide a complete record of all actions taken in the procurement process, facilitating regulatory audits. Additionally, ERP platforms can be configured to generate reports required by regulatory bodies, reducing the burden on compliance teams and ensuring timely submissions.
Implementation Considerations for Healthcare ERP
Implementing an ERP system for healthcare procurement requires careful planning and execution. The process begins with a thorough assessment of current procurement processes, identifying pain points, and defining requirements. This phase involves engaging stakeholders from procurement, finance, inventory, and clinical operations to ensure that the ERP solution meets their needs. Next, the organization selects an ERP vendor and configures the system to align with its business processes. Configuration includes setting up item master data, vendor records, contract terms, and workflow rules. This phase is critical for ensuring that the ERP system supports the organization's unique procurement requirements.
Data migration is a key component of ERP implementation. Historical procurement data, including purchase orders, invoices, and vendor records, must be migrated to the new system. This process requires data cleansing, validation, and mapping to ensure accuracy and consistency. Testing is another critical phase, where the ERP system is rigorously tested to identify and resolve issues before go-live. User acceptance testing (UAT) involves end-users testing the system in a simulated environment to ensure that it meets their needs. Training and change management are also essential for ensuring user adoption. By following a structured implementation approach, healthcare organizations can minimize risks and maximize the benefits of their ERP investment.
Future Trends in Healthcare Procurement ERP
The future of healthcare procurement ERP is shaped by emerging technologies such as artificial intelligence (AI), machine learning (ML), and blockchain. AI and ML can enhance procurement operations by providing predictive insights, automating decision-making, and identifying anomalies. For example, AI algorithms can analyze historical data to predict demand fluctuations and recommend optimal inventory levels. ML models can identify patterns in vendor performance, enabling proactive risk management. Blockchain technology can improve transparency and trust in supply chains by providing an immutable record of transactions. These technologies have the potential to transform healthcare procurement, making it more efficient, resilient, and patient-centric.
Cloud-based ERP solutions are also gaining traction in healthcare procurement. Cloud ERP offers scalability, flexibility, and lower upfront costs compared to on-premises solutions. It enables healthcare organizations to access procurement data from anywhere, facilitating remote work and collaboration. Additionally, cloud ERP providers regularly update their systems with new features and security patches, ensuring that organizations stay current with technological advancements. As healthcare organizations continue to digitize their operations, cloud-based ERP will play a pivotal role in enabling agile, data-driven procurement strategies.
